Risk stratification by CT coronary angiography 12,16,18-20

Risk of cardiovascular eventAngiographic findings
HighDisease of left main or left anterior descending coronary artery, three-vessel disease with proximal stenoses
IntermediateSignificant lesion in large and proximal coronary artery, but no high-risk features
LowNormal coronary artery or non-obstructive plaques
